Understanding Plateaus Through the CICO and Metabolic Adaptation Lens
Plateaus are a normal physiologic response rooted in the fundamental principle of Calories In, Calories Out (CICO). When consistent caloric deficits persist, the body adapts by lowering basal metabolic rate (BMR) and non-exercise activity thermogenesis, sometimes by 5–15% according to studies in the journal Obesity. This adaptive thermogenesis explains why scale weight may stabilize even as body composition continues to improve.
Research published in The New England Journal of Medicine demonstrates that plateaus frequently coincide with improved insulin sensitivity rather than failure. Tracking biomarkers such as HOMA-IR (calculated from fasting glucose and insulin) often reveals continued metabolic progress even when weight remains flat. A dropping HOMA-IR score below 2.0 signals reduced hyperinsulinemia—the hormonal driver that locks fat storage—independent of the scale.
